About the Job: The Project Lead manages strategy execution and tracking of delivery outcomes, including the overall cadence across the governance structure, to ensure alignment to business value and successful completion of project initiatives. As the Project Lead you will operate as a key advisor to Yum! senior leadership and drive disciplined decision-making across the program. The Project Lead reports directly to the VP of the Major Programs Office. You will be required to attend the Plano, TX office three days per week (Tuesday - Thursday). Salary Range: $125,200-$150,000 + bonus eligibility. This is the expected salary range for this position. Ultimately, in determining pay, we'll consider the successful candidate’s location, experience, and other job-related factors. Primary Responsibilities: Drive end-to-end strategy execution for program initiative development and delivery, ensuring alignment to enterprise priorities and value realization targets Lead integrated project planning, including complex dependency management, risk mitigation, and scenario planning across multiple workstreams and functions Establish and run program governance cadence, including preparation for key decision forums, ensuring timely, high-quality decisions Deliver insight-driven, executive-ready reporting that links progress to financial and operational outcomes Proactively identify, analyze, and resolve ambiguous, cross-functional challenges with broad business impact Influence and challenge senior stakeholders (including VP-level and external partners/franchisees) to drive alignment and accountability Ensure program discipline and execution rigor across functions, elevating standards beyond “business as usual” Act as a trusted advisor to senior leadership, providing recommendations on risks, trade-offs, and strategic decisions Maintain the program master plan (e.g., milestones, owners, risks) Strategic and structured thinker who can simplify complexity and connect execution to business outcomes Strong influencing and stakeholder management skills, including the ability to challenge senior leaders constructively Advanced analytical and problem-solving capabilities with a focus on actionable insights Excellent executive communication skills (written and verbal) High ownership mindset with the ability to drive pace and accountability across teams Minimum Requirements: 10+ years leading large, complex, cross-functional programs with enterprise-level impact Proven experience managing ambiguity and undefined problems, translating them into structured plans Strong background in governance, risk management, and dependency orchestration across multiple teams Experience influencing senior leaders and cross-functional stakeholders in matrixed organizations Familiarity with transformation programs or large-scale operational project management preferred Benefits: Employees (and their eligible family members) may enroll in the following types of insurance coverage: medical, dental, vision, legal, and accidental death and dismemberment, as well as FSA/HSA (depending on enrolled medical plan). Yum! also provides short-term disability, long-term disability, and life insurance. Employees may enroll in our 401(k) plan. Yum! provides 4 weeks of vacation, paid sick leave, 10 paid holidays, a floating day off and 2 paid days for volunteer time each calendar year. To learn more about working at Yum! - Click here.
